首页 > TAG信息列表 > DSL

ElasticSearch深度分页详解

1 前言ElasticSearch是一个实时的分布式搜索与分析引擎,常用于大量非结构化数据的存储和快速检索场景,具有很强的扩展性。纵使其有诸多优点,在搜索领域远超关系型数据库,但依然存在与关系型数据库同样的深度分页问题,本文就此问题做一个实践性分析探讨2 from + size分页方式from + size

DataFrame操作数据的两种方式(SQL和DSL)

SQL方式 需要将DataFrame注册成为一张临时表,并给临时表起名字,通过SQL语句查询分析DataFrame中数据 局部临时表、全局临时表 [注意]: --1 如果我们注册的是全局表,查询全局表的时候,必须在表名前加上一个数据库的名字global_temp val frame = session.sql("select sex, count(*) as n

dsl查询queryResults转page

private static final long serialVersionUID = 1L; //元素内容 private List<T> content; //是否有上一页 private boolean first; //是否有下一页 private boolean last; //当前页 private int number; //当页条数 private int num

分布式搜索引擎--es

1.DSL查询文档 elasticsearch的查询依然是基于JSON风格的DSL来实现的。 1.1.DSL查询分类 Elasticsearch提供了基于JSON的DSL(Domain Specific Language)来定义查询。常见的查询类型包括: 查询所有:查询出所有数据,一般测试用。例如:match_all 全文检索(full text)查询:利用分词器对用户输

6. 从ods(贴源层)到 dwd(数据明细层)的两种处理方式(spark)-dsl

6. 从ods(贴源层)到 dwd(数据明细层)的两种处理方式(spark) 6.1 使用spark dsl 方式处理 6.1.1 注意事项 # 开启hive元数据支持,开启之后在spark中可以直接读取hive中的表,但是开启之后就不能再本地云心的了 .enableHiveSupport() # 这下脚本都是作用在dwd层,所以必须在dwd的用户下执行,

02-DSL操作Elasticsearch入门

六、DSL操作ES 6.1、RESTful风格介绍 REST(Representational State Transfer 表述性状态转移),是一组架构约束条件和原则,满足这些约束条件和原则的应用程序或设计就是RESTful。就是一种定义接口的规范。有以下特征: 基于HTTP 可以使用XML格式定义或JSON格式定义参数和返回值。 每一

从零开始实现lmax-Disruptor队列(五)Disruptor DSL风格API原理解析

MyDisruptor V5版本介绍 在v4版本的MyDisruptor实现多线程生产者后。按照计划,v5版本的MyDisruptor需要支持更便于用户使用的DSL风格的API。 由于该文属于系列博客的一部分,需要先对之前的博客内容有所了解才能更好地理解本篇博客 v1版本博客:从零开始实现lmax-Disruptor队列(一)Ring

ubuntu拨号上网

1、在ubuntu的应用菜单中找到“高级网络配置”,然后点击它 2、接着点击左下角的加号,选择创建一个“DSL/PPPOE”连接 3、接着编辑连接,上级接口选择“enp2s0”,用户名输入宽带账号,密码则是宽带密码 4、最后还要记得选择有线网络为刚刚设置的DSL连接 参考资料:https://www.cnblogs.com/g

(转)领域特定语言DSL——无代码开发的技术“内核”

    https://blog.csdn.net/qq_42738998/article/details/123067997     在由轻流主办的第二届「无代码未来趋势论坛」上,上海交通大学沈备军老师发表了主题演讲。 她从学术角度为大家讲述了无代码开发的技术内核。 以下为沈备军的演讲全文: 大家好,我是沈备军,来自上海交通大学软

状态机引擎在vivo营销自动化中的深度实践 | 引擎篇02

一、业务背景 营销自动化平台支持多种不同类型运营活动策略(比如:短信推送策略、微信图文推送策略、App Push推送策略),每种活动类型都有各自不同的执行流程和活动状态。比如短信活动的活动执行流程如下: (图1-1:短信活动状态转移) 整个短信活动经历了 未开始 → 数据准备中 → 数据已就

DSL 和 reactive 噩梦

Kotlin 之美—DSL篇 - 掘金 像 Compose 那样写代码 :Kotlin DSL 原理与实战_fundroid_方卓的博客-CSDN博客 先找好一个靶子: val yesterday = 1.days.ago 请问,谁记得这个写法?除了这个发明人谁会记得应该这么敲?为什么不是 1.days.before,为什么不是 now.24.hour.ago?它能处理 1/4 的前

【Android Gradle 插件】ProductFlavor 配置 ( 测试相关配置 | versionNameSuffix 配置 | applicationIdSuffix 配置 )

文章目录 一、测试相关配置二、ProductFlavor#useJack 配置三、ProductFlavor#versionNameSuffix 配置四、ProductFlavor#applicationIdSuffix 配置五、应用id后缀、版本号后缀 配置示例 Android Plugin DSL Reference 参考文档 : 文档主页 : https://google.github.io/

用于 Elasticsearch 查询的查询 DSL Builder

用于 Elasticsearch 查询的查询 DSL Builder Install composer require whereof/elastic-builder //需要自行安装 https://github.com/elastic/elasticsearch-php composer require elasticsearch/elasticsearch version elasticsearch Version Requirement Version 7.0 o

Gradle Kotlin DSL 多模块项目案例

版本信息 ide: idea2020.1 jdk: openjdk8 gradle: 6.8.3 搭建项目 新建 Gradle 项目 选择 gradle,勾选 Kotlin DSL构建脚本,最后下一步: 自定义项目的名称、groupId、artifactId和version: 项目初始结构: 修改 settings.gradle.kts 文件 rootProject.name = "module-demo" /

关于SQL语句转DSL语句的一些实践和思考(一)

现在接触的项目是公司的路由中台,每天的数据量是亿级别的,同时要记录每一次请求的详细数据 开始的时候这些记录数据是存放到elasticsearch与DB2数据库中各自保存 当需要查询某个路由信息的详情时从ES中获取,速度非常快,当想获取统计报表的时候从DB2中统计,本来是相安无事的,ES速度

Kotlin学习(10)使用Kotlin创建DSL,2021安卓开发面试题及答案

DSL(领域特定语言)指的是专注于特定问题领域的计算机语言。不同于通用的计算机语言(GPL),领域特定语言只用在某些特定的领域。 DSL语言能让我们以一种更优雅、更简洁的方式的方式来表达和解决领域问题。 简单来讲就是对一个特定的问题的方案模型更高层次的抽象表达,使其更加简单易

14-Query DSL---范围查询

/ / / / 前缀查询是根据每一个分词的前缀来查询 / / / / / / / / / / / /

13-Query DSL---查询所有---关键词查询

/ / / / / / / / / / / / / / /

你应该知道的kotlin实用技巧

前言 众所周知,kotlin是google力推的用以取代java的android开发语言 kotlin使用起来比较方便,同时有许多语法糖 本文主要讲解了一些比较实用的kotlin技巧 自定义圆角矩形 在项目中,我们常常要定义圆角矩形背景,一般是用自定义drawable实现的 但是圆角矩形的背景与圆角常常会有细微的变

es-DSL语句-index管理操作相关

版本为7.3.2,主要记录index,settings,mappings相关的操作,方便快速测试,调试 创建一个动态mapping的index,并指定某些字段,允许新字段 put    http://10.192.78.27:39200/<index_name> {  "mappings": {     "dynamic": "true",     "properties": {        "id&q

Python Elasticsearch DSL 搜索

  使用ElasticSearch DSL进行搜索   Search主要包括:   查询(queries)过滤器(filters)聚合(aggreations)排序(sort)分页(pagination)额外的参数(additional parameters)相关性(associated)   创建一个查询对象   from elasticsearch import Elasticsearch   from elast

Autosar DCM 诊断(Diagnostic Communication Manager)

诊断数据流,管理诊断状态,尤其诊断会话和安全状态。 诊断服务是否支持,根据诊断状态判断当前的诊断复位是否在当前会话执行。 PDUR-DCM-Application(ID from the DCM)  DCM design组成: • High-Level Design (HLD ) :执行 DCM 的 ID 接口 • Low-Level Design (LLD) :具体

es DSL语法

kibana版 GET _search { "query": { "match_all": {} } } #测试分词器 POST /_analyze { "text":"程序员", "analyzer":"ik_max_word" } #创建索引库 PUT page { "mappings": { "properties

DSL查询ES结果排序

elasticsearch默认是根据相关度算分(_score)来排序,但是也支持自定义方式对搜索结果排序。可以排序字段类型有:keyword类型、数值类型、地理坐标类型、日期类型等。 1.普通字段排序 keyword、数值、日期类型排序的语法基本一致。 语法: GET /indexName/_search {   "query": {  

DSL查询ES文档

1.DSL查询分类 Elasticsearch提供了基于JSON的DSL(Domain Specific Language)来定义查询。常见的查询类型包括: 查询所有:查询出所有数据,一般测试用。例如:match_all 全文检索(full text)查询:利用分词器对用户输入内容分词,然后去倒排索引库中匹配。例如: match_query multi_match_